Transaction 43bd190fea7ff50069d5216654faadf403de1f03eb4753a88062e828677b96ff

1 Input
2 Outputs
  • 43bd190fea7ff50069d5216654faadf403de1f03eb4753a88062e828677b96ff:0
  • value  172152
    address  39N6UNKenHvfWhK1yCmW73Xo2QmVGAXorL
  • 43bd190fea7ff50069d5216654faadf403de1f03eb4753a88062e828677b96ff:1
  • value  2380044
    address  1P5rXfNuXwB9FZ8YyFbjaupebXnWKLbA8D